Providing Glasses in the US How to Apply for Assistance

IMPORTANT: New Eyes for the Needy is unable to accept individual applications for eyeglass vouchers due to a decline in funding and an increase in requests for assistance.

If you have a social worker, case worker or agency that you work with, they may be able to help you submit an Agency Application.

Agency applications will be reviewed. If approved, the agency will receive a voucher on behalf of the client.

Applicants from Kentucky

Clients in Kentucky receive their vouchers through Kentucky Homeplace, a program that links medically underserved rural residents with free or low-cost health services.

If you live in Kentucky, you must request an application from Kentucky Homeplace by:
